Discover the profound insights of one of history's greatest philosophers with Plato Opera Vol. V, published by Oxford University Press in 1963. This hardback volume spans an impressive 612 pages and includes essential texts such as Minos, Leges, and various epistles, alongside the lesser-known works classified as Deff. and Spuria.
